Motor Power and Speed

The MAXSHOT boasts a powerful 250W motor, allowing it to reach speeds of up to 9 mph. In contrast, the VOLPAM features an 80W motor, with a maximum safe speed of just 5 mph. This difference in motor power equates to the MAXSHOT being 80% faster than the VOLPAM. For older kids or adults, the higher speed of the MAXSHOT makes it more suitable for commuting or longer rides. Meanwhile, the VOLPAM’s lower speed may appeal to younger children or beginners, providing a safer learning environment.

Safety Features

Safety is a crucial consideration for any parents choosing a scooter for their children. The MAXSHOT includes a double safety braking system with both a hand brake lever and a rear foot fender brake, providing reliable stopping power. In contrast, the VOLPAM features a kick start mode and a lean-to-steer technology, which helps younger riders develop balance. While both scooters have safety features, the MAXSHOT’s dual braking system gives it an edge for older or more adventurous riders who may need more robust safety measures.
